The
Associate Field Service Engineer will be responsible for providing FANUC America Corporation customers with onsite repair, troubleshooting, programming, or maintenance services for FANUC robots and related system equipment on an emergency or unscheduled basis.
The Field Service Engineer must be able to travel to a customer site at a moment's notice and remain onsite for the duration of time required to perform the troubleshooting, maintenance or repair functions. The assignments may involve long hours, nights, weekends, and holiday work. This position requires complying with FAC and customer schedules, work rules, and conduct standards.
The ideal candidate is a customer-focused, problem-solver with a "service first" mindset who has experience with FANUC technology.
Primary responsibilities will include:- Discuss, diagnose, and repair robot operational and process problems as reported by the customer or technical support hotline.
- Troubleshoot, repair, and maintain FANUC robot mechanical units and controllers and electrical control devices.
- Document robot and related equipment performance, failure modes and reporting results for the purpose of troubleshooting, repairing, maintaining and restarting the system.
- Provide a daily report to the Service Supervisor/Manager & Dispatch to update status and availability.
- Complete customer calls to understand the required parts and software needed for the visit.
- Complete a Field Service Report after each customer call that describes the problem, the corrective action, and details the labor, material, and travel expense costs to provide to the customer and return to FAC for processing.
- Maintain a service tool kit and documentation to facilitate rapid customer response.
- Participate in the rotation of the Hot Pager for afterhours service support.
- Coordinate responsibilities, activities, and schedule with Service Supervisor/Manager to ensure customer satisfaction, proper billing, and collections.
- Communicate frequently with involved FAC employees and customer employees to ensure that expectations are being met.
- Return parts shipped for the service call but not purchased by the customer or defective parts replaced under warranty.
- Provide telephone-based troubleshooting support to customer employees to resolve robot or related peripheral equipment operational problems on an as needed basis.
- Travel to customer sites as required.
